PlayStation Games That Revolutionized Their Genres

The best PlayStation games don’t just entertain—they often redefine entire genres, setting new standards for innovation and player engagement. Over the decades, Sony’s consoles have been home to genre-defining titles that pushed boundaries and changed player expectations forever. slot gacor online From action-adventure epics to immersive RPGs, these revolutionary games showcase PlayStation’s commitment to innovation.

Consider the “God of War” series, which reinvented the hack-and-slash genre with its fluid combat system, cinematic storytelling, and epic scale. The 2018 installment shifted gears with a more mature narrative and RPG elements, influencing countless action games that followed. It didn’t merely build on the past; it transformed the genre’s potential.

Another milestone is “Bloodborne,” which reshaped the action RPG with its fast-paced, aggressive combat and gothic horror atmosphere. It took the “Soulslike” formula and added a unique identity, inspiring a wave of similar games on and beyond PlayStation platforms. Its design encouraged risk-taking, rewarding player skill rather than brute force.

In the open-world genre, “Horizon Zero Dawn” introduced a fresh post-apocalyptic setting dominated by robotic creatures, blending exploration, stealth, and dynamic combat. Its innovative enemy AI and narrative depth raised expectations for open-world storytelling on PlayStation.

Even niche genres benefited—“LittleBigPlanet” revolutionized platformers by adding user-generated content, enabling players to design and share levels. This idea of player creativity as a core mechanic influenced many games across platforms.

By fostering genre-defining PlayStation games, Sony has ensured that some of the best games are not just fun but transformative, expanding the possibilities of what gaming can be.
